Output 39acf5defc7191ebdb6727af7f111cdddcaaf39ee5954333fc234de7d6cb272a:3

value
101778
script pubkey
OP_0 OP_PUSHBYTES_32 06d0708809b8d3dec82a404941190b2f85428309a468da2c97086b32ecd426a4
address
bc1qqmg8pzqfhrfaajp2gpy5zxgt97z59qcf535d5tyhpp4n9mx5y6jqn8fa4z
transaction
39acf5defc7191ebdb6727af7f111cdddcaaf39ee5954333fc234de7d6cb272a
confirmations
98774
spent
true